India will look to end the fourth and final Test against England on a winning note and seal the series before the start of the T20I  tournament.

However, the Virat Kohli-led India will not let the guards down as the fourth Test has more than the series at stake as the spot in the final of the World Test Championship (WTC) against New Zealand is what is needed to be earned.

England, on the other hand, has nothing to lose as they are already out of the WTC competition, so they surely look to disrupt India's chances as well.

When will India vs England 4th Test match start?    

The India vs England 4th Test match will begin at 9:30 AM IST on Thursday (March 4).

Where will India vs England 4th Test match be played?    

The India vs England 4th Test match will be played at Narendra Modi Stadium in Ahmedabad.    

Which TV channels will broadcast India vs England 4th Test match?      

The India vs England 4th Test match will be broadcast on Star Sports Network on TV.    

How to watch the live streaming of the India vs England 4th Test match?     

Fans can catch the live streaming of the match on the Disney+ Hotstar app and website.  

Playing XIs

India: Rohit Sharma, Shubman Gill, Cheteshwar Pujara, Virat Kohli (c), Ajinkya Rahane, Rishabh Pant, Washington Sundar, Ravichandran Ashwin, Axar Patel, Ishant Sharma, Mohammed Siraj. 

England: Zak Crawley, Dominic Sibley, Dan Lawrence, Jonny Bairstow, Joe Root, Ben Stokes, Ollie Pope, Ben Foakes, Dominic Bess, James Anderson, Jack Leach.
